2. Comprehending Prescription Drugs: Brand vs. Generic
One of the first things a consumer encounters at a USA drug store is the option-- or do not have thereof-- between brand-name and generic medications.
By law, the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) needs generic Buying Drugs Illegally to have the exact same active ingredients, strength, dose form, and path of administration as their brand-name equivalents. However, they are normally cost a portion of the cost.

Pointer: Unless a physician writes "Dispense as Written" (DAW) on the prescription, a lot of United States state laws and insurance coverage strategies mandate that pharmacists replace a brand-name drug with its generic comparable to save the client cash.

Often Asked Questions (FAQ)Can I use a foreign prescription at a USA drug store?
No. United States drug stores can not lawfully fill prescriptions composed by physicians who are not accredited to practice medicine within the United States. If you are a worldwide tourist requiring medication, you must visit a local US physician or immediate care center to have a brand-new prescription composed.
Do I require health insurance to use a USA pharmacy?
No. Anybody can walk into an US pharmacy and fill a prescription without insurance. Nevertheless, without insurance or a discount rate coupon, you will be expected to pay the full money market price, which can be very costly.
What is a Pharmacy Benefit Manager (PBM)?
A PBM is a third-party company that manages prescription drug benefits on behalf of health insurance companies, large companies, and Medicare Part D plans. They negotiate drug prices with makers and create formularies that dictate which drugs are covered and just how much clients pay.
Can I move my prescription to a various drug store?
Yes. If you want to change drug stores for better pricing or benefit, just ask your new pharmacy to call your old pharmacy. They will deal with the transfer process for a lot of basic medications (leaving out certain regulated substances, which might require a new prescription from your doctor).
What should I do if my insurance coverage rejects protection for my medication?
If your insurance coverage denies a drug, your physician can submit a Prior Authorization (PA) demand describing why the medication is medically essential. If that stops working, your doctor might be able to recommend an alternative medication that is covered by your strategy's formulary.
